Done and Gifted!
The quilted wallhanging I made for my son's apartment is finished!! I love how it turned out and I had fun making it. He loves it too. I wanted to use variegated thread but the day I had planned for quilting we had a big snowstorm and I couldnt get to the fabric store to buy the colour I needed so I just used what I had. I used a gold on top and purple in bobbin (the backing fabric is purple with white circles). I also did a decorative stitch around the centre portion. I made a scrappy binding (love scrappy bindings!) Here's a pic of the blocks I started with and then cut in quarters and sewed two sets back together. The finished size is 60" x 36"
